  1. Lonesome Ghosts is a 1937 Disney animated cartoon, released through RKO Radio Pictures on Christmas Eve, three days after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s (1937). It was directed by Burt Gillett and animated by Izzy (Isadore) Klein, Ed Love, Milt Kahl, Marvin Woodward, Bob Wickersham, Clyde Geronimi, Dick Huemer, Dick Williams, Art Babbitt, and ...

  2. Lonesome Ghosts is a Mickey Mouse short that was released on December 24, 1937. Four ghosts, bored with having nobody around to scare, decide to look in the phone book and call some ghost exterminators to mess around with. Mickey Mouse, Donald Duck, and Goofy arrive, are subject to the ghosts...

  8. The Lonesome Ghosts are the titular main antagonists in the 1937 Disney animated short of the same name, and three of the supporting antagonists in Mickey's House of Villains. They are a quartet of translucent green phantoms named Jasper, Grubb, Boo, and Moss who like to play tricks on anybody who enters their house.
